Food Banks and Shelters
One of the most rewarding volunteer opportunities is to help out at a local food bank or shelter. You can help by sorting and distributing food, preparing meals, serving food to those in need, and even cleaning up after meals.
Animal Shelters
Another great way to give back to your community is by volunteering at an animal shelter. You can help by walking dogs, socializing cats, cleaning cages, and assisting with adoption events.
Parks and Recreation
If you love spending time outdoors, volunteering at a local park or recreation center might be the perfect fit for you. You can help by planting trees, cleaning up litter, maintaining hiking trails, and assisting with community events.
Schools and Libraries
Volunteering at a local school or library can be a great way to help out your community while also improving your own skills. You can help by tutoring students, assisting with homework, shelving books, and even teaching classes.
Hospitals and Nursing Homes
If you have a caring personality and enjoy helping others, volunteering at a hospital or nursing home might be the perfect fit for you. You can help by visiting patients, assisting with meals, and even providing entertainment.
Environmental Organizations
If you are passionate about protecting the environment, consider volunteering with a local environmental organization. You can help by planting trees, cleaning up litter, and educating others about the importance of environmental conservation.
Community Centers
Volunteering at a local community center can be a great way to give back to your community and meet new people. You can help by organizing events, assisting with activities, and even teaching classes.
Non-Profit Organizations
There are many non-profit organizations in your community that rely on volunteers to help them achieve their goals. You can help by assisting with fundraising events, organizing campaigns, and even serving on the board of directors.
Political Campaigns
If you are passionate about politics, consider volunteering for a local political campaign. You can help by canvassing neighborhoods, making phone calls, and even assisting with campaign events.

Local volunteering opportunities can be a great way to give back to your community while also gaining valuable skills and experience. However, like any opportunity, there are both pros and cons to consider before committing your time and energy.
Pros
- Opportunity to make a difference: Volunteering locally allows you to directly impact the lives of those in your community. Whether it’s through feeding the homeless, mentoring youth, or cleaning up your neighborhood, your efforts can make a real difference.
- Professional development: Volunteering can help you develop new skills and gain experience that can be beneficial in your career. For example, volunteering at a local non-profit can give you experience in grant writing, event planning, and fundraising.
- Networking: Volunteering can also provide opportunities to meet new people and expand your network. You may meet individuals who can offer job leads, provide references, or become valuable connections in your industry.
- Personal fulfillment: Many people find that volunteering brings a sense of personal satisfaction and fulfillment. Helping others can boost your mood and overall well-being.
Cons
- Time commitment: Volunteering can be time-consuming, especially if you take on a leadership role or commit to a long-term project. It’s important to carefully consider your schedule and ensure that you have the necessary time to devote to the opportunity.
- Unpaid work: While volunteering can provide valuable experience, it’s important to remember that it is typically unpaid work. If you are looking for paid work, volunteering may not be the best use of your time.
- Potential for burnout: Volunteering can be emotionally taxing, especially if you are working with vulnerable populations or tackling difficult issues. It’s important to set boundaries and take care of your own well-being to avoid burnout.
- Limited impact: While volunteering locally can make a difference in your community, it may not have a wider impact. If you are looking to make a larger impact, you may need to consider volunteering on a national or international level.
Overall, local volunteering opportunities can be a great way to give back to your community while also gaining valuable skills and experience. However, it’s important to carefully consider the pros and cons before committing your time and energy to ensure that it is the right fit for you.

How do I find local volunteering opportunities?
There are several ways to find local volunteering opportunities:
- Check with local non-profit organizations or charities
- Contact your city or county volunteer center
- Search online for volunteer opportunities in your area
- Ask friends, family, and colleagues for recommendations
